Origin

Costa Coffee is a global coffeehouse chain with over 1700 locations in the United Kingdom and abroad. The company was created by Italian brothers Sergio Costa and Bruno Costa in 1971. It started as wholesaler, supplying roasted espresso coffee to local caterers, and specialty Italian coffee shops. Later, it expanded into retailing opening its first store in 1978. The company's signature blend is Mocha Italia, a slow-roasted mix of Arabica and Robusta. Costa offers a range of other drinks, such as cappuccino or espresso.

The company is renowned for its quality and consistency. The brand is also known for its commitment to ethical and sustainable sources, as well as its support for initiatives for the community. The stores are well-designed and have a welcoming atmosphere. Costa has a strong presence in the UK, where it is the second largest branded coffee shop chain, after Starbucks. The headquarters of the company is in Dunstable (England).
